Real life Belgium couple, Danny Mommens and Els Pynoo are Vive La Fête, which means “long live the party”. The band first caught my attention when they chose to cover Lio’s “Bannana Split” and made it more electro on their Hot Shot EP (2005).

Apparently these guys are quite popular in the fashion world because Germany designer, Karl Lagerfeld is one of their biggest fan.

Not counting their compilation and remix albums, Jour de Chance is their 5th album since they started releasing CDs in 2000.

“Une Par Une” sounds a lot like Stereo Total[W♥M] to me. It’s my favorite song, next to the remix of “La Route”.

The remix of “La Route” actually appears on their latest remix EP called Jour de Chance Remixs which features the an altered image of the original album artwork.
